Questions & Answers

Q: How does gallium contribute to the manufacturing of atom bombs?

Gallium, when mixed in a small amount with plutonium, helps in the shaping and hot pressing of the plutonium sphere for controlled detonation, ensuring precise packing and preventing premature explosion.

Q: Why is shaping the plutonium sphere crucial in atom bomb production?

Shaping the plutonium sphere is vital as it allows for denser packing of plutonium atoms to prevent neutron escape, aiding in controlled chain reactions during detonation.

Q: What challenges were faced in shaping pure plutonium into a sphere?

Pure plutonium was difficult to mold, resulting in a flaky and unsuitable structure. Adding gallium altered the atomic arrangement, enabling easier molding into spheres for atom bomb production.

Q: How does gallium impact the overall size and safety of atom bombs?

By aiding in plutonium sphere fabrication, gallium allows for denser packing of plutonium, increasing the amount that can be safely included in the bomb, enhancing efficiency while maintaining safety protocols.
